Grasping Synthetic Data Production: Significance & Consequences
The rise of AI generation tools has sparked both excitement and apprehension across numerous sectors. At its core, AI generation involves algorithms—often powered by advanced learning models—that can generate new content, be it copy, visuals, audio, or even programming. This potential isn't simply about mimicking existing material; it’s about learning patterns and relationships within vast datasets to formulate something novel. The consequences are far-reaching, potentially reshaping industries from content creation and learning to design and scientific research. Understanding how these systems function, along with their intrinsic limitations and ethical considerations, is vital for navigating this evolving landscape and leveraging its benefits while addressing its risks.
Generating an Artificial Narrative: A Practical Manual
Embarking on the quest of producing an AI-powered narrative might seem daunting, but breaking it down into understandable steps makes it surprisingly accessible. First, you'll need to establish the parameters – what category will your narrative be? Science fiction, fantasy, or perhaps something entirely different? Next, evaluate the narrative structure; will it be a traditional beginning, middle, and end, or something more experimental? Then, you’ll pick your AI platform. Large Language LLMs like GPT-3 or similar alternatives are commonly used for text generation. You'll want to explore with various queries to steer the AI's responses towards your desired outcome. Don't be afraid to refine and modify your prompts to get the finest possible tale. Finally, remember that AI-generated narratives often require human intervention to ensure coherence and a complete storytelling!
